The story follows Martha Ivers as she attempts to escape her wealthy aunt, accidentally kills her during a power outage, and is blackmailed into marrying her tutors son to cover it up, but years later the truth is revealed when her childhood friend returns to town and Walter tries to kill him. The Strange Love of Martha Ivers is a 1946 American English-language Drama Film-Noir film featuring Barbara Stanwyck, Van Heflin, Lizabeth Scott, Kirk Douglas, Judith Anderson, Roman Bohnen and Max Wagner. The movie is inspired from Love Lies Bleeding by John Patrick. Hal Wallis Productions was the production house involved in the project along with executive producer(s) Hal B. Wallis. The Strange Love of Martha Ivers is written by Robert Rossen and Robert Riskin and it is directed by Lewis Milestone, Byron Haskin and Hal B. Wallis. Paramount Pictures acquired the distribution rights for the motion picture. The Strange Love of Martha Ivers was released on 19th August 1946 and takes a screen time of 116 minutes. and it received positive reviews from critics when it was released. The movie made a box office gross of $3 million. Cinematography was done by Victor Milner and editing by Archie Marshek. The music was composed by Mikl S R Zsa.
